On your iPhone if someone calls you and you can’t hear them unless you turn on speaker then you need to make few changes in settings like increasing ringer volume slider and other simple methods to fix these can’t hear calls, iphone not ringing on calls or sound issue on your iPhone 13, 12 or 11 or any other iPhone series. So, let’s dive in deeper to fix these no sound on call issues when you cant hear other peoples voice on calls.
By following below troubleshooting methods you can easily get rid of no sound until you turn on speaker or any sound related or not getting notification and other issue.
Hard Reset (force Restart)
To hard reset your iPhone you need to press volume up button and now quickly press volume down button, now after that you need to hold the side button until you see apple logon on your screen.
Step 1: Launch settings app
Step 2: Scroll down and tap on Accessibility option and tap on it.
Step 3: Now, Scroll down again and tap on Audio / visual option.
Step 4: In here, tap on Noise Cancellation option and turn it off.
Once you turn off noise cancellation on iPhone you ear speakers should be working fine. If not follow other below solutions.
Also Read: 1) How to Fix Sound issue on iPhone 13 mini, 13 pro max, iPhone 12, iPhone 11, iPhone X
2) How to fix iPhone shows volume turned down: Sound and Haptics
3) iPhone 12 Pro Notification Comes With No Sound Or Alert
4) Fix: Hide Alert Messages Keeps Turning On its own on iPhone | iOS 14.4 Even Turned Off
5) Solved – Bluetooth Headphones too Loud on Lowest Setting iphone (iOS 14.5)
Turn off Bluetooth
Some times yout device may be connected to other bluetooth device and you may not notice that and you turn on speaker you get to hear sound unless speaker is on. So, go ahead and turn off bluetooth.
Open settings -> Tap on bluetooth settings and turn it off and check your calls are working with normal ear speaker or not.
Check Sound on Your Device
Step 1: Launch Settings app on your iPhone
Step 2: Tap on Sounds and Haptics (depending on your model of iPhone)
Step 3: Now, you need to drag the ringer and alerts volume and check whether your sound is working or not.
If you hear no sound or greyer out or no sound in sounds and haptics you may need a service for your iPhone mobile.
Clean Ear Speakers
On your iPhone if ear speaker is filled with dust or any other particles like sweat etc, you need to clean your ear speakers by using toothpick or soft brush which is able to clear font speaker opening on iPhone and blow some air with your mouth to get rid of dust inside ear speakers.
Reset All Settings to fix Can’t Hear calls unless speaker is ON
Step 1: Tap on Settings -> General
Step 2: Scroll down and tap on Transfer or Reset -> Reset All settings
Step 3: Now, select reset in pop up box and confirm reset process and wait for reset process to complete.
That’s it, once you reset your iPhone will be working fine without any sound issues or cant hear people on call etc.
Why can’t I hear my phone calls unless it’s on speaker?
If your iPhone is configured with improper settings and your volume is set to low or your iPhone is connected to other nearby bluetooth or wifi available devices or outdated software on iPhone iOS 15 or 16.
Shruti is BSC Computer Graduate and Author and Editor at A Savvy Web and She has an expertize and provides solutions and troubleshooting tips and solutions for iPhone, iPad, MacBook and Windows Computers, Android, Smart tv Expert and She is More Enthusiastic in this area of expertise and a Real time expert.
Are you unable to hear phone calls unless you switch over to the speaker on your iPhone? If yes then in this post we will help you to fix the issue.
Why Are You Getting This Issue use?
There can be many reasons why you are getting the problems. Below we shared three major possibilities which may be causing the issue.
How To Fix If You can’t Hear Phone Calls unless on speaker on iPhone?
Solution 1: Restart Your iPhone
The first thing you should try is Restarting your phone. It can fix temporary issues with your iPhone.
Solution 2: Use Your Phone In Safe Mode
As I mentioned above in the article, it’s also possible that any of your recently downloaded apps with mic permission may be causing the issue.
To find out if this is the case or not, you can boot your iPhone in safe mode.
Solution 3: Make Sure Your iPhone Volume Is Set To High While Calling
We will also suggest you to quickly check if your phone speaker volume is set to high during the call. Smartphones allow users to customize the volume level while calling.
Solution 4: Clean your Earpiece Port
It’s very common for the Earpiece Port to accumulate debris, and as a result, you may be hearing issues while calling. So we will recommend you to check the Earpiece port for any debris.
And if you find any debris then clean it carefully. Once your iPhone Earpiece port is clean, check if now you can hear the other people over call.
Solution 5: Update the Software to the latest version
Any temporary software glitch can also be the culprit. So we will suggest you to check for any pending software updates for your iPhone.
Note: Before updating your iPhone, it’s recommended to backup your iPhone data. Also, make sure that you are connected to a working internet connection.
Solution 6: Factory Reset
If any of the troubleshooting doesn’t work then the last possible fix is to Factory Reset your device.
Note: Before Factory Reset your iPhone, it’s recommended to backup your iPhone data.
Solution 7: Contact iPhone Service Center
If after trying everything you are still getting the issue then there can be some hardware issue which can only be addressed from the iPhone service center. So contact any nearest iPhone Service Center.
Like This Post? Checkout More